Ah yes Madame Webb, a mentor with a trickster spirit mentality whom despite all her mystical psychic powers is very much a different type of Grandma figure in Spider man's life. (Does genuinely want to aid Spider Man but is more trying to get his act together and definitely won't take any backtalk from Spidey.) Anyways Madame Webb's debut was in the 90's Spider Man series in which she was voiced by Joan Lee whom is most known as Stan Lee's wife. (Which lets just say explains why Stan called Madame an "Exotic Lady" in his cameo appearance on the show.) But still unlike Joan's dear old hubby she has only very rarely appeared in Marvel Comic Adaptations with her performance as Madame Web being her most known performance and fortunately its a very good performance to be known for. While its no surprise that Joan was very much able to do an elderly voice considering on how she was very much elderly even back then but I always did like her performance for the role as its not only very mysterious but has a nice elegant touch that doesn't seem too regal. It was definitely one of the better performances in that show as it was a great fit for the role.Madame Webb never had a voice acted part again until Spider Man Shattered Dimensions came along and this time she was voiced by Susanne "Cruella DeVille" Blakeslee whom is a rather suitable alternative. Susanne was able to do a nice elderly voice and her performance certainly gave a wise and sagacious feel and while it may seem a little less energetic as Joan's but it works rather well for the role nevertheless. Overall I suppose I am going with Joan in the end but both of these ladies did really well with this role.
